NASHVILLE, Tenn. — With quarterback Diego Pavia shadowing the coaching staff instead of taking snaps, the rest of the Vanderbilt offense captured the Black and Gold Spring Game, 40-38, on Saturday afternoon at FirstBank Stadium.
Fifth-year head coach Clark Lea, the E. Bronson Ingram Chair in Football, saw his sides go back and forth on a sun-splashed Saturday afternoon. The defense got off to a strong start, forcing two early turnovers, before the offense rebounded in the second quarter and eventually secured the win.
With Pavia secure in his starting role, Lea and offensive coordinator Tim Beck got an extensive look at the remaining signal-callers. Drew Dickey, Blaze Berlowitz, Jérémy St-Hilaire and Whit Muschamp all saw full contact with a final chance to play this spring.
The scrimmage marked the conclusion of spring practice. The team will now prepare for final exams and a short break in May before returning at the end of the month to begin summer workouts. The 2025 season begins back at FirstBank Stadium on Aug. 30 against Charleston Southern.
